Chappell Roan Responds to Jorginho's Criticism Over Security Incident

American singer Chappell Roan has responded after Brazilian footballer Jorginho accused her security of aggressive behaviour towards his wife and stepdaughter at a hotel in São Paulo. The former Chelsea and Arsenal midfielder posted on Instagram claiming that his 11-year-old stepdaughter was left 'extremely shaken and cried a lot' after a security guard spoke to her and her mother in an 'extremely aggressive manner'.

Jorginho, who now plays for Flamengo, said his stepdaughter had spotted Roan at breakfast and smiled while walking past her table, but did not approach the singer. He accused Roan of not appreciating her fans, writing: 'Without your fans, you would be nothing.'

In a video posted to Instagram, Roan said she did not see the incident and that the security guard involved was not her personal security. She explained: 'I did not ask the security guard to go up and talk to this mother and child. They did not come up to me. They weren't doing anything. It's unfair for security to just assume someone doesn't have good intentions.'

Roan apologised to the mother and child, stating: 'If you felt uncomfortable, that makes me really sad. You did not deserve that.' She also rejected claims that she dislikes fans or children, calling such suggestions 'crazy'.

The incident has sparked online criticism, including from Rio de Janeiro's mayor Eduardo Cavaliere, who said on X that Roan was not welcome to perform at the city's Todo Mundo no Rio festival. Roan previously spoke out about fan boundaries in 2024, criticising 'entitled' and 'creepy' behaviour.
